About Olivia
Olivia Studdard has built a strong foundation in dance education through years of training and performance. She began with recreational classes and advanced to competitive studio dance, mastering styles including ballet, jazz, tap, acrobat, and lyrical. In high school, she served as co-captain of the dance team during her senior year before joining the college dance team at Grand Canyon University, where her program achieved national championships in two divisions last year. Olivia currently teaches in studios around the valley and creates choreography for both competitive and recreational performances. She is pursuing a bachelor's degree in entrepreneurial studies along with minors in dance performance, business management, and biblical studies at Grand Canyon University, with plans to graduate in 2027. Her long-term goals include dancing professionally on a cruise line and eventually opening her own dance studio to foster confidence and skill development in aspiring artists. Faith plays a central role in her journey and approach to challenges in the dance world.
